/**
* Class to contain a single folder element representation.
*
*/
public class BluetoothMapFolderElement {
private String mName;
private BluetoothMapFolderElement mParent = null;
private boolean mHasSmsMmsContent = false;
private long mEmailFolderId = -1;
private HashMap<String, BluetoothMapFolderElement> mSubFolders;
private static final boolean D = BluetoothMapService.DEBUG;
private static final boolean V = BluetoothMapService.VERBOSE;
private final static String TAG = "BluetoothMapFolderElement";
public BluetoothMapFolderElement( String name, BluetoothMapFolderElement parrent){
this.mName = name;
this.mParent = parrent;
mSubFolders = new HashMap<String, BluetoothMapFolderElement>();
}
public String getName() {
return mName;
}
public boolean hasSmsMmsContent(){
return mHasSmsMmsContent;
}
public long getEmailFolderId(){
return mEmailFolderId;
}
public void setEmailFolderId(long emailFolderId) {
this.mEmailFolderId = emailFolderId;
}
public void setHasSmsMmsContent(boolean hasSmsMmsContent) {
this.mHasSmsMmsContent = hasSmsMmsContent;
}
/**
* Fetch the parent folder.
* @return the parent folder or null if we are at the root folder.
*/
public BluetoothMapFolderElement getParent() {
return mParent;
}
/**
* Build the full path to this folder
* @return a string representing the full path.
*/
public String getFullPath() {
StringBuilder sb = new StringBuilder(mName);
BluetoothMapFolderElement current = mParent;
while(current != null) {
if(current.getParent() != null) {
sb.insert(0, current.mName + "/");
}
current = current.getParent();
}
//sb.insert(0, "/"); Should this be included? The MAP spec. do not include it in examples.
return sb.toString();
}

public byte[] encode(int offset, int count) throws UnsupportedEncodingException {
StringWriter sw = new StringWriter();
XmlSerializer xmlMsgElement = new FastXmlSerializer();
int i, stopIndex;
// We need index based access to the subFolders
BluetoothMapFolderElement[] folders = mSubFolders.values().toArray(new BluetoothMapFolderElement[mSubFolders.size()]);
if(offset > mSubFolders.size())
throw new IllegalArgumentException("FolderListingEncode: offset > subFolders.size()");
stopIndex = offset + count;
if(stopIndex > mSubFolders.size())
stopIndex = mSubFolders.size();
try {
xmlMsgElement.setOutput(sw);
xmlMsgElement.startDocument("UTF-8", true);
xmlMsgElement.setFeature("http://xmlpull.org/v1/doc/features.html#indent-output", true);
xmlMsgElement.startTag(null, "folder-listing");
xmlMsgElement.attribute(null, "version", "1.0");
for(i = offset; i<stopIndex; i++)
{
xmlMsgElement.startTag(null, "folder");
xmlMsgElement.attribute(null, "name", folders[i].getName());
xmlMsgElement.endTag(null, "folder");
}
xmlMsgElement.endTag(null, "folder-listing");
xmlMsgElement.endDocument();
} catch (IllegalArgumentException e) {
if(D) Log.w(TAG,e);
throw new IllegalArgumentException("error encoding folderElement");
} catch (IllegalStateException e) {
if(D) Log.w(TAG,e);
throw new IllegalArgumentException("error encoding folderElement");
} catch (IOException e) {
if(D) Log.w(TAG,e);
throw new IllegalArgumentException("error encoding folderElement");
}
return sw.toString().getBytes("UTF-8");
}
